Runbook note for the weekly sync: the Kestrelcache bloom filter sits in front of the Pellet key-value store and absorbs roughly 40% of negative lookups. If false-positive rates climb above 2%, the filter needs a rebuild, which takes about six minutes and runs online. Rebuilds are triggered manually for now. The current production settings are listed below.

deployment values, kajep-kageg:
[praix]
host = praix.paliqcorp.corp
user = praix_svc
database = praix_prod

# Reconciliation job for the Stockmere inventory service.
#
# This job compares warehouse counts against ledger entries and
# queues corrections for any drift beyond tolerance. It runs in
# fixed-size batches to avoid locking hot SKU rows, and backs off
# when the ledger replica lags. Reviewers: check that batch sizing
# matches replica capacity. The tuning constants are defined below.

tuning constants:
QUOTAS = {
    "druwyn": 5,
    "holix": 5,
    "zorath": 5,
    "holwyn": 10,
}

### Runbook: AgriPulse Gateway — restart after cert rotation

Symptoms: tractors report but dashboards show stale telemetry. Cause: gateway drops MQTT sessions when the broker cert rotates. Fix: drain the Harrowfield node (`agripulse drain gw-2`), stop the gateway, and rebuild its env file from the vault template. Confirm `AGRIPULSE_BROKER_HOST` and `AGRIPULSE_REGION=harrowfield` are intact. Then, on the following line, add the entry that sets the broker auth secret.

sealed setting: LEDGER_TOKEN29=130a4f7ada97c8be1e00128e577ab

### Step 2: Switch to cursor pagination

Offset pagination is removed in v5 of the Larkspool API. All list endpoints now return a `next_cursor` field; pass it back via the `cursor` query parameter. Requests using `offset` return 400. Page size is capped at 200; requests above the cap are clamped, not rejected. Update your plugin's fetch loops to stop on a null cursor. Your client must also be initialized with the new pagination settings shown here.

settings of kajep-kawip:
[zorys]
host = zorys.urlaqgrid.corp
user = zorys_svc
database = zorys_prod